Transaction 31863dc027570089123d3211aba42beb3533abd1631734152b1e4bf17159466d

1 Input
2 Outputs
  • 31863dc027570089123d3211aba42beb3533abd1631734152b1e4bf17159466d:0
  • value  400000
    address  3K3Frft7VJkZFALyYjq9PEb23Y9os5N2JF
  • 31863dc027570089123d3211aba42beb3533abd1631734152b1e4bf17159466d:1
  • value  585844
    address  1JQvKUGLgLPoqgSzi8bbmzUoYK35ShTfFd